Transaction edcf37deae2c8717bb5c0c4df29bbee1507133e7d38406cfae8633d602034a41
2 Input
2 Outputs
- edcf37deae2c8717bb5c0c4df29bbee1507133e7d38406cfae8633d602034a41:0
- edcf37deae2c8717bb5c0c4df29bbee1507133e7d38406cfae8633d602034a41:1
value 21000000
address 152cbtDvjyYso6X8LfxCE9TEX8zg4TMa6J
value 135964
address 1AWgML48ej3EuJQyAedv9qUPSQLS2ykxkQ